Record activity observed across Europe's logistics markets

by Property Forum
According to Savills, the e-commerce boom is continuing to drive demand for industrial and logistics assets across Europe, as new records were set for both levels of investment and leasing activity in 2021. In Poland, take-up in 2021 reached an all-time high and industrial assets accounted for over a half of the total investment volume.

European multifamily investments record 79% increase

by Property Forum
Driven by large-scale mergers and acquisitions, European multifamily investment volumes in the 12 countries analysed reached approximately €92.3 billion in 2021, a 79% increase year-on-year and a 120% increase on the past five-year average, Savills announces.

European residential investment volume reaches new record

by Property Forum
Record levels of investment poured into European residential assets last year, with spending nearly equal to that of office investment, Knight Frank reports. Just shy of €100 billion of assets were traded in the European residential investment sector in 2021, up 60% on 2020, analysis of data from RCA shows.

Savills IM's transaction volume reaches €4.1 billion in 2021

by Property Forum
Savills Investment Management, the international real estate investment manager, transacted more than €3.4 billion globally in 2021, including c. €2.6 billion in Europe and c. €670 million in Asia. Globally, transactions included around €2.1 billion of acquisitions and around €1.2 billion of disposals, resulting in a net investment of c. €900 million. The firm now manages approximately €24.8 billion in assets under management (AuM) as of September 2021

Investment demand in Europe picks up alongside capital value expectations

by Property Forum
The Q4 2021 results of the RICS Global Commercial Property Monitor indicate a continued improvement in market sentiment across Europe compared to the previous quarters, with progress particularly evident on the investment side of the market. That said, conditions remain polarised at the sector level, with the latest feedback still signalling a challenging set of circumstances for retail while industrials continue to post robust expectations for the twelve months ahead.
